WebMar 19, 2024 · The Grand Canyon officially became a national park on February 26, 1919. In 2024, the Grand Canyon was the 2nd most visited park in the United States, with 4.7 million visitors. The Grand Canyon is one of the Seven Natural Wonders of the World as well as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Your preferred mode of travel and accommodation preferences may determine which rim of the Grand … WebJul 16, 2024 · The Grand Canyon is the only National Park that has a public school residing within its boundaries. It is a small school with only 15 students in last year’s graduating class. The village also has its own police station and clinic that serve the county residents and 3,000 or so park employees.
